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es, for small areas No DIY is fine for small areas, but it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ent water damage.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age. Call a pro to ensure safe and effective water removal.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can hide hidden water damage and mold growth. A professional assessment is necessary to ensure safe and effective repairs.
Storm surge damage to coastal home No Yes Storm surge damage can be extensive and need specialized equipment and expertise to restore your home safely and effectively.
Small roof leak with minimal damage Yes, for minor repairs No DIY is fine for minor repairs, but ensure you address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and safety risks.
Extensive storm damage to entire home No Yes A professional assessment and repair are essential for extensive storm damage to ensure safe and effective restoration of your home.

While DIY might seem like a cost-effective option for minor issues, it’s essential to remember that storm damage restoration needs specialized equipment, expertise, and insurance knowledge to ensure your home is restored to its original condition.

Storm Damage Restoration Cost in the 36604 Area

The cost of storm damage restoration in the 36604 area can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and prices may vary.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, extent of water dam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Mold Inspection and Testing $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of mold growth
Containment and Air Filtration $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Mold Removal from Drywall $1,500 – $3,500 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Post-Remediation Verification $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of remediation
